## Configuration

The Bramblehart build vendors licensed typefaces from the Glyphden foundry mirror at build time rather than committing binaries to the repository. Each fetched font is checksum-verified against the manifest in fonts/lock.json, and any mismatch aborts the build. The mirror requires an authenticated pull, and the credential never appears in build logs. For a reviewer reproducing the build, add the foundry credential to the local .env as the following line:

sealed setting: VAULT_KEY3=eec

**Ticket QV-4182: Config hot-reload silently drops nested keys**

When Lanternd receives a SIGHUP, top-level settings reload fine, but nested blocks under `limits:` revert to compiled defaults. No error is logged, so operators believe the new values took effect. Reproduced on staging with the throttle config. Workaround: full restart. Fix should land in the next patch train; verify against the build token below.

build token for kagaf-hahof: htk14_9d3d4d26d7d8de

Welcome to on-call for the Glimmerpane design system! Our snapshot tests live in the `snapcheck` suite and run on every merge to main. If a UI component changes visually, the diff bot flags it — usually it's an intentional tweak, so just approve the new baseline. If it's 2am and snapshots are failing across the board, it's almost always a font-loading race, not your problem. To unlock the baseline store and re-approve snapshots in bulk, use the recovery passphrase below.

recovery phrase for tahag-taguf: wenix-caswyn